WitrynaThere are two likely ancestors for most Ryans, depending on which part of Ireland they come from. Many Ryans from the West of Ireland can trace their roots back to a 9th century chieftain called Maelruain. His descendants took the name O’Maelruain. WitrynaThe Massie family name was found in the USA, the UK, Canada, and Scotland between 1840 and 1920. The most Massie families were found in USA in 1880. In 1840 there were 36 Massie families living in Virginia. This was about 39% of all the recorded Massie's in USA.
